Transaction 395293685feded7c8ed82f8f74f0b0f9e8f5350125b73ae78ac99b00e00ba984
1 Input
1 Output
-
395293685feded7c8ed82f8f74f0b0f9e8f5350125b73ae78ac99b00e00ba984:0
- value
- 475318
- script pubkey
- OP_0 OP_PUSHBYTES_20 4b45eaecf427db45ae9c12156805b551317fddec
- address
- bc1qfdz74m85yld5tt5uzg2kspd42ychlh0vauvwnl